Product Overview

In industrial robotics and automated manufacturing systems, servo drivers are essential components for achieving accurate motion control, high positioning precision, and reliable robot operation. Servo drive modules regulate motor current, speed, and torque to ensure smooth movement of robotic axes and automated machinery.

The ABB (KUKA) KSD1-48 E93DA123I4B531 00-117-344 Servo Driver is an industrial servo drive module designed for KUKA KRC2 robot control systems and high-performance motion control applications. It provides precise servo motor control for industrial robots, supporting stable operation in demanding manufacturing environments.

The KSD1-48 belongs to the KSD1 servo driver family and is designed for applications requiring higher current output capability compared with lower-capacity models. It is widely used in robotic axis control, industrial automation equipment, and multi-axis motion systems.

With dimensions of 200 × 120 × 50 mm and a weight of 1.96 kg, the KSD1-48 features a compact modular design suitable for installation inside robot controllers and industrial control cabinets.


Technical Specifications

Parameter Details
Manufacturer ABB (KUKA)
Model KSD1-48
Part Number E93DA123I4B531
Order Number 00-117-344
Product Type Servo Driver
Application Industrial Robot Motion Control
Drive Type Digital Servo Drive Module
Input Type DC Bus Power Input
Output Type Servo Motor Control Output
Control Mode Position / Speed / Torque Control
Current Class 48A Servo Drive
Compatible System KUKA KRC2 Robot Controllers
Installation Type Control Cabinet Mounting
Cooling Method Air Cooling
Dimensions 200 × 120 × 50 mm
Weight 1.96 kg

Function and Working Principle

The ABB (KUKA) KSD1-48 Servo Driver converts electrical power into controlled output signals for servo motors, allowing industrial robots to perform accurate and coordinated movements.

The basic operating process is:

DC Power Input → Servo Control Processing → Power Amplification → Servo Motor Output

The working process includes:

  1. The servo driver receives DC power from the robot power supply system.
  2. The control circuit processes position, speed, and torque commands.
  3. Power switching components regulate current delivered to the servo motor.
  4. The servo motor performs the required mechanical movement.
  5. Encoder feedback allows continuous adjustment and correction.

Through closed-loop control, the KSD1-48 maintains accurate positioning and stable operation for robotic applications.

Common Failure Symptoms

Fault Symptom Possible Cause
Servo motor does not move Power supply problem
Robot axis alarm Servo driver fault
Position deviation Encoder feedback problem
Motor vibration Incorrect parameters
Overheating Cooling problem
Motion interruption Communication issue

Troubleshooting Guide

Check Power Supply

Inspect:

  • DC input voltage
  • Power connections
  • Protection circuits

Unstable power may prevent proper servo operation.


Check Motor Wiring

Verify:

  • Motor cable connections
  • Encoder wiring
  • Connector condition

Incorrect wiring may cause movement errors.


Check Feedback System

Inspect:

  • Encoder signals
  • Feedback cables
  • Position feedback data

Feedback faults may result in inaccurate movement.


Check Servo Parameters

Review:

  • Motor configuration
  • Speed settings
  • Torque limits
  • Control mode

Incorrect parameters may affect performance.
